来源:小编 更新:2024-12-05 09:14:57
用手机看
3D游戏设计是指通过计算机技术,将虚拟世界中的角色、场景、故事等元素以三维形式呈现给玩家。它融合了艺术、编程、物理、数学等多个领域的知识,旨在为玩家提供沉浸式的游戏体验。
3D游戏开发需要掌握多种技术,包括但不限于以下几方面:
图形渲染技术:负责将3D模型、场景等元素以图像形式展示给玩家。
物理引擎:模拟游戏中的物理现象,如重力、碰撞等。
音效处理:为游戏添加背景音乐、音效,增强玩家的沉浸感。
人工智能:设计智能NPC,使游戏更具挑战性。
3D游戏设计需要关注以下核心要素:
故事情节:一个引人入胜的故事是吸引玩家的关键。
角色设计:角色形象要鲜明,具有个性。
场景设计:场景要具有真实感,符合游戏主题。
游戏机制:游戏规则要合理,易于玩家理解。
3D游戏开发流程大致可以分为以下几个阶段:
需求分析:明确游戏类型、目标受众、核心玩法等。
设计阶段:包括故事情节、角色、场景、游戏机制等设计。
开发阶段:根据设计文档进行编程、建模、音效制作等。
测试阶段:对游戏进行测试,修复bug,优化性能。
发布阶段:将游戏发布到各大平台,供玩家下载。
沉浸式体验:通过VR、AR等技术,为玩家提供更加沉浸式的游戏体验。
个性化定制:根据玩家喜好,提供个性化的游戏内容。
跨平台游戏:实现不同平台间的游戏互通,扩大玩家群体。
3D游戏设计与开发是一项充满挑战与机遇的领域。通过本文的介绍,相信您对3D游戏有了更深入的了解。在这个充满创意与技术的时代,让我们一起探索虚拟世界的无限可能吧!